Giter Site home page Giter Site logo

project-sitnu's People

Contributors

bziya avatar thenoim avatar

Stargazers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ar

Watchers

 avatar  avatar  avatar  avatar  avatar  avatar

project-sitnu's Issues

Releases IPAs

It would be really useful if you release compiled IPAs so everyone can sideload them if they have altstore or something else.

Add Lessons together

If two lessons are the same and without a break, add the times for the timer (45min+45min –> 90min)...

Idea/Suggestion :)

I have some subjects that are paralellel so: some ppl have spanish, some habe cs. I would like them to be next to each other like shown in the picture. Or if its possible: select what subjects to show or not to show in the app. image

And this is what it looks like right now in the sitnu watchapp:
image
image

So to clarify: in the 2nd/3rd picture its below each other and i want it to be besides each ither like in the official app(1st picture). Or as i said to be able to select what subject to show or not to show. :)
Do it when you have time. Best wishes David

Got removed from TestFlight

Hi there, I noticed that I got removed from the TestFlight app and can’t join. As I use the app almost daily, this is not very optimal for me.
Please could you add me again?

Select a different Timetable

How hard would it be to add the ability to change the timetable? (like my school haven't setup "my timetable" see image and i have to chose a timetable for my class instead)

if you could give me a nod in the right direction i can implement it myself

Screenshot 2024-01-16 at 17 55 50

Bug when clicking on a lesson

If you click on a lesson, nothing is displayed, under WatchOS 9 you could go back via the Digital Crown and click again, then it worked. This is now a problem under WatchOS 10, because you can no longer go back via the Digital Crown. So it's not possible to see the details of an lesson. I don't know if this is only a bug on my Watch (Series 8) or a general one.

Watch App is not installing

Hello

I have the Apple Watch Series 3 with runs on watchOS 8 I installed the app on my iPhone with TestFlight but I can't install the app on the watch it's just starting to load but it don't finish. Is there a way to fix this? When I close the watch app it just restarts to download. image

TestFlight Beta Expired

It would be nice when you could create a new link. Alternatively I would be willing to give you my login data for the purpose of apple reviewing it for the AppStore. But I will ask my headmaster if they could create a account in order that they could these it with a test account
Greetings
gamersi

Apple Watch App won't load since upgrade to WatchOS 10

I have tried uninstalling and reinstalling and restarting and reading the account, it is stuck on loading accounts with a loading icon which isn't moving

Here's the log:

09:04:56.171 DEBUG AppDelegate.application():37 - Added file destination
09:04:56.192 DEBUG WatchConnectivityStore.initialize():142 - WCSession activated
09:04:56.196 WARNING WatchConnectivityStore.loadFromKeyChain():183 - Missing Account data in KeyChain. Set store to []
09:04:56.198 DEBUG WatchConnectivityStore.sessionReachabilityDidChange():48 - sessionReachabilityDidChange to false
09:04:56.201 ERROR LogFiles.loadLogFiles():22 - The folder “Log” doesn’t exist.
09:04:56.203 DEBUG WatchConnectivityStore.session():30 - activationDidCompleteWith activationState=2 error=nil
09:05:02.793 DEBUG WatchConnectivityStore.sessionWatchStateDidChange():35 - sessionWatchStateDidChange
09:05:09.849 DEBUG WatchConnectivityStore.sessionReachabilityDidChange():48 - sessionReachabilityDidChange to true
09:05:18.968 DEBUG SchoolSearchView.body():44 - Call search
09:05:21.186 DEBUG SchoolSearchView.body():44 - Call search
09:05:22.525 DEBUG SchoolSearchView.body():44 - Call search
09:05:23.088 DEBUG SchoolSearchView.body():44 - Call search
09:05:23.994 DEBUG SchoolSearchView.body():44 - Call search
09:05:25.721 DEBUG SchoolSearchView.body():44 - Call search
09:05:27.124 DEBUG SchoolSearchView.body():44 - Call search
09:06:07.988 DEBUG ResponseSerializer.serialize():50 - Start serializing
09:06:07.996 DEBUG ResponseSerializer.serialize():54 - Got this as result ["result": Optional(1714979098837)]
09:06:08.014 DEBUG WatchConnectivityStore.sync():161 - Sync accounts: [Project_SITNU.UntisAccount(id: 73FC80D7-0B58-4E56-ABB0-FCEDF3ACAEEA, username: "", password: "", server: "asopo.webuntis.com", school: "htblva_villach", setDisplayName: Optional("HTL"), authType: Project_SITNU.AuthType.PASSWORD, primary: true, preferShortRoom: false, preferShortSubject: false, preferShortTeacher: false, preferShortClass: false, showRoomInsteadOfTime: false)]
09:06:08.019 DEBUG WatchConnectivityStore.sync():168 - Send credentials to other device
09:06:09.880 DEBUG WatchConnectivityStore.sessionReachabilityDidChange():48 - sessionReachabilityDidChange to false
09:06:57.064 DEBUG LogFileViewer.loadLines():64 - Load lines for log ["path": "/var/mobile/Containers/Data/Application/B285ACAD-2E84-4DCE-96FB-638A8879DC46/Documents/Log/sitnu-ios.log"]
09:07:03.839 DEBUG LogFileViewer.body():54 - Already loaded
09:07:50.194 DEBUG LogFileViewer.loadLines():64 - Load lines for log ["path": "/var/mobile/Containers/Data/Application/B285ACAD-2E84-4DCE-96FB-638A8879DC46/Documents/Log/sitnu-ios.log"]
09:09:38.577 DEBUG LogFileViewer.loadLines():64 - Load lines for log ["path": "/var/mobile/Containers/Data/Application/B285ACAD-2E84-4DCE-96FB-638A8879DC46/Documents/Log/sitnu-ios.log"]
09:09:44.559 DEBUG LogFileViewer.body():54 - Already loaded
09:09:49.013 DEBUG AppDelegate.application():37 - Added file destination
09:09:49.023 DEBUG WatchConnectivityStore.initialize():142 - WCSession activated
09:09:49.026 DEBUG WatchConnectivityStore.session():30 - activationDidCompleteWith activationState=2 error=nil
09:09:49.029 DEBUG WatchConnectivityStore.loadFromKeyChain():193 - Successfully restored account data into store
09:09:49.031 DEBUG WatchConnectivityStore.sessionReachabilityDidChange():48 - sessionReachabilityDidChange to false
09:10:00.670 DEBUG LogFileViewer.loadLines():64 - Load lines for log ["path": "/var/mobile/Containers/Data/Application/B285ACAD-2E84-4DCE-96FB-638A8879DC46/Documents/Log/sitnu-ios.log"]

Unknown WebUntis error

IMG_7904

It says it is an unknown error, which isnt very helpful... any ideas why that is.
obviously I downloaded it in testflight etc..

IPA not installing

Because of Issue #32 I tried to install the IPA with Altstore (Altstore is working I have tried installing other IPA's and it worked) and Altstore crashed right at the end the App-install process it's now on the home screen (shown in picture below)
WqkiJ0Oghk

When you open the App, you immediately get this error:

Iv6AtqC2go
Translated into english it means that the App can't be installed and that you should try again later.

Url is not valid

I think it's because my school-name has an space(" ") in it so the app doesn't work. how can I fix this?

"Break" instead of "End"

Hi, so I have the app installed on my Apple Watch and instead of showing "end" after school it shows "break". On a different watchface it shows "end". Where's the problem?

Won’t start at the Apple Watch Ultra

Hello 👋

my friend has a new Apple Watch ultra and I recommend him this app but the app won’t start on his watch

Here the log:

08:04:09.633 DEBUG AppDelegate.application():35 - Added file destination
08:04:09.645 DEBUG SceneDelegate.session():17 - WCSession activated ["activationState": 2]
08:04:09.655 DEBUG SceneDelegate.sessionWatchStateDidChange():66 - WCSession state changed ["isWatchAppInstalled": false, "isPaired": true]
08:04:16.555 DEBUG SceneDelegate.sessionWatchStateDidChange():66 - WCSession state changed ["isWatchAppInstalled": true, "isPaired": true]
08:04:27.549 DEBUG AppDelegate.application():35 - Added file destination
08:04:27.558 DEBUG SceneDelegate.session():17 - WCSession activated ["activationState": 2]
08:04:27.564 DEBUG SceneDelegate.sessionWatchStateDidChange():66 - WCSession state changed ["isWatchAppInstalled": true, "isPaired": true]
08:04:33.962 DEBUG AppDelegate.application():35 - Added file destination
08:04:33.979 DEBUG SceneDelegate.session():17 - WCSession activated ["activationState": 2]
08:04:33.984 DEBUG SceneDelegate.sessionWatchStateDidChange():66 - WCSession state changed ["isPaired": true, "isWatchAppInstalled": true]
08:04:40.898 DEBUG SchoolSearchView.body():44 - Call search
08:04:46.123 DEBUG SchoolSearchView.body():44 - Call search
08:04:46.823 DEBUG SchoolSearchView.body():44 - Call search
08:04:49.340 DEBUG SchoolSearchView.body():44 - Call search
08:04:56.656 DEBUG SchoolSearchView.body():44 - Call search
08:04:57.272 DEBUG SchoolSearchView.body():44 - Call search
08:04:58.527 DEBUG SchoolSearchView.body():44 - Call search
08:05:03.868 DEBUG SchoolSearchView.body():44 - Call search
08:05:05.059 DEBUG SchoolSearchView.body():44 - Call search
08:05:08.305 DEBUG SchoolSearchView.body():44 - Call search
08:06:08.799 DEBUG AppDelegate.application():35 - Added file destination
08:06:08.826 DEBUG SceneDelegate.session():17 - WCSession activated ["activationState": 2]
08:06:08.829 DEBUG SceneDelegate.sessionWatchStateDidChange():66 - WCSession state changed ["isWatchAppInstalled": true, "isPaired": true]
09:11:14.830 DEBUG AppDelegate.application():35 - Added file destination
09:11:14.845 DEBUG SceneDelegate.session():17 - WCSession activated ["activationState": 2]
09:11:14.849 DEBUG SceneDelegate.sessionWatchStateDidChange():66 - WCSession state changed ["isWatchAppInstalled": true, "isPaired": true]
09:11:20.240 DEBUG SchoolSearchView.body():44 - Call search
09:17:53.888 DEBUG SchoolSearchView.body():44 - Call search
09:17:58.908 DEBUG setschool?url=mese.body():91 - Code
09:17:58.918 DEBUG SchoolSearchView.body():126 - key: censored user: censored school: censored url: censored
09:18:10.757 DEBUG ResponseSerializer.serialize():54 - Start serializing
09:18:10.765 DEBUG ResponseSerializer.serialize():58 - Got this as result ["result": Optional(1668064820989)]
09:24:49.247 DEBUG LogFileViewer.loadLines():64 - Load lines for log ["path": "/var/mobile/Containers/Data/Application/A53CE414-09DD-44AC-94BD-2BCC87C2C7E0/Documents/Log/sitnu-ios.log"]
09:24:57.441 DEBUG LogFileViewer.body():54 - Already loaded

> Is there a way to put this app into app store?

          > Is there a way to put this app into app store? 

Read the readme under the section TestFlight

Originally posted by @gamersi in #20 (comment)

What does „If you want to donate your login, then I can submit the app to the app store“ mean? I can send him my logins, because its my schools and i dont care. Is that what it mean?

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.